            En Passant (Malle) is a natural suggestion...lilacs, a touch of fresh bread, not overtly feminine.

            Otherwise, some random suggestions. None are too feminine (to me anyway):

            -La Tulipe by Byredo ($$$) (green floral-mishmash)
            -Lily by CDG ($$) (green lily)
            -Iris 39 by Le Labo ($$$) (green patchouli-floral)
            -Unicorn Spell by LesNez ($$) (green violet)
            -Le Temps d'Une Fete by Parfums Nicolai ($$) (green narcissus)

            If those are too pricey, I can suggest cheaper mall stuff. Most lilac scents smell cheap and air-freshener-like, aside from the Malle, although Yves Rocher's is decent, but closer to mimosa than lilac.
